Well, i met my clients at 7 am due to they forgot to get the Miss's a license. so while i was waiting for them to return, i hit Lost Creek area below the "Cold Hole" with Angler_Josh and showed him what i could in the dark. caught a fish on the 1st cast. then 2 more within 15 minutes, and then my clients came back from the store, ready to go fishing... so i told Josh where to go and left him on his own...

I took them (clients) to Cardiac Hill to start out first so i could teach them how to roll cast and get away from people if we could. there were only 4 guys there, so we walked about 200-300 yards down stream. My client told me to focus on his wife mainly, to try to get her more interested in fly fishing, so he could take her when they went fishing again. Within 10 minutes of teaching her the "Roll Cast", she finally placed the fly where i wanted her to put it, and immediately hooked a fish. Looked to be about 20 plus inches after it jumped out of the water and broke off. She was holding the fly line to tight and broke her off.... bummer. They caught 4 i think out of the spillway area, then i took them to Lost Creek area near the Cold Hole and found a couple big big big bow's spawning. she hooked one of them and it jumped again, but this time it threw the hook. in this one little pocket, she hooked about 5 five and i think landed 2....? pretty good for never fly fishing before.-- with the current and learning how to play a fish w/o horsing it, she did very well..... Proceeded to hook fish throughout the day, but still she got to excited and broke most of them off.... at least 15-20 fish. (i need to tie a lot of fly's now) but she was super happy and cant wait to get into them next time. i tried to talk them into coming back to the river later, after their family thing, and they said they might. I didnt have time to show them how to fish the Evening Hole, and i told them if they came back i would spend a little more time with them since i had nothing to do the rest of the day, but fish... but i guess they went back to FTW... wish they came back because around 3 pm it turned on!

but after the trip around noon,i picked josh back up, and we ate lunch and i tied ten fly's up and hit the water. Josh has never been fly fishing before and within a 1/2 an hour of showing him the ropes we started to tear into them. i have taken him fly fishing for bass a couple times , so i did not have to teach him to cast or anything. all i had to do is tell him what fly to use and where. the afternoon bite was on fire! almost every fish was 17 inches on average with a about 3-4 that were 20-21 inches. i was sitting next to the river and josh called my name and i looked over at him and he was fighting a fish. the weird thing was, he was in that little stagnant water next to the evening hole. i guess when they had the gates open a couple got stuck in there. i made a cast in the little hole and immediately also caught another fish out of it. caught 2 out of it and josh got 3.

All the bigger fish were on a modified woolly bugger i tie for that river. and then the rest were on my Broken Bow Special Midge that i tie as well. at the end of the day right before dark i tied on an egg pattern, due to they were nailing my indicator. i picked up about a dozen or so on that, and then i just could not see my indicator anymore and we called it a day.
